Climate-Aware Material Intelligence Engine

Uses satellite weather data + regional climate models to recommend material types for modular buildings (e.g., moisture-resistant wall panels in coastal areas).
Factors in thermal performance, corrosion resistance, cost, and sustainability scores.
Example Output: “Use fly ash concrete + aluminum composite for buildings in humid zones of Kerala.

AI-Based Material Refinement Recommender

Suggests refinements or coatings for locally available materials to match performance standards.
Uses ML models trained on historical durability data and construction failure logs.
Can suggest additions like nano-coatings, fire-resistant treatments, or thermal barriers based on use-case.

AI-driven skill mapping tool that assesses existing construction workers’ capabilities.
Recommends personalized upskilling paths (e.g., CNC machine operation, prefab assembly, robotic supervision).
Integrated with local training centers or government skilling schemes like Skill India.

India's push for rapid urban infrastructure development is hindered by three interconnected challenges:

Inappropriate Material Usage: Construction materials are often selected based on availability and cost, not on climate compatibility. This leads to heat inefficiency, moisture retention, or degradation in harsh environments like coastal, desert, or high-altitude zones.

Low Material Optimization: There is minimal use of data-driven refinement or performance prediction in choosing or treating materials, leading to increased long-term maintenance costs.

Labor-Heavy Ecosystem: India's construction industry is largely manual and informal, lacking the automation skillsets required for a prefab modular assembly line approach.
